Human: MH 1965.10.C.G Bust of Isis, circa 2nd century CE (Hadrianic period, 117-138 CE) Roman Masterpiece Hollow-cast bronze craftsmanship Measuring 4 1/2 in x 2 5/8 in x 1 3/8 in; 11.4 cm x 6.7 cm x 3.5 cm in overall size Purchased with the Nancy Everett Dwight Fund and the Psi Omega Society Fund, honoring Mary Gilmore Williams (Class of 1885) A prized addition to the Mount Holyoke College Art Museum collection, located in South Hadley, Massachusetts Created by Emily Lankiewicz's skillful hand.
